Nursery Manager Job Description

About the Role

We are seeking a passionate and experienced Nursery Manager to lead our team and ensure the highest standards of care, education, and compliance within our nursery. This is a fantastic opportunity for an individual with strong leadership skills, a deep understanding of early years education, and a commitment to creating a safe, nurturing, and stimulating environment for children.

Key Responsibilities

* Oversee the daily operations of the nursery, ensuring all policies, procedures, and regulatory requirements are met

* Lead, motivate, and manage a team of early years professionals to deliver outstanding care and education

* Develop and implement a high-quality curriculum in line with the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) framework

* Ensure the safeguarding and welfare of all children, promoting a safe and inclusive environment

* Manage nursery budgets, occupancy levels, and financial performance to support business success

* Build strong relationships with parents, carers, and external agencies to support children's development and well-being

* Conduct regular staff training, appraisals, and performance reviews to ensure professional development

* Maintain accurate records and documentation in compliance with Ofsted and other regulatory bodies

* Drive continuous improvement, identifying opportunities to enhance nursery standards and practices

Requirements

* Minimum Level 3 qualification in Early Years Education or equivalent (Level 5 or above preferred)

* Proven experience in a managerial role within an early years setting

* Strong knowledge of the EYFS framework, safeguarding procedures, and Ofsted requirements

* Excellent leadership, communication, and interpersonal skills

* Ability to manage budgets, occupancy, and operational targets effectively

* Passionate about delivering high-quality childcare and early education

* A commitment to fostering a positive and supportive team culture
